On February 2, 2026, KKR & Co. Inc. (NYSE: KKR) experienced a modest increase in its stock price, closing at $114.36, which represents a slight gain of $0.10 or 0.09% from the previous day’s close of $114.26. The stock opened at $114.15 and reached a high of $116.08 during the trading day, while the lowest price recorded was $112.63. The trading volume for the day was notable, totaling approximately 5.16 million shares, indicating active market participation.

Acquisition of Singapore Data Center Firm:
KKR is reportedly leading a consortium that is set to acquire a Singapore-based data center firm valued at over $10 billion. This acquisition aligns with KKR’s strategy to expand its footprint in the technology infrastructure sector, which could enhance its portfolio and revenue streams. Quarterly Earnings Preview:
Analysts are anticipating KKR’s upcoming quarterly earnings report, scheduled for February 4, 2026. Expectations suggest earnings of $1.21 per share, reflecting a decline of 8.3% year-over-year.
